CROTALARIA JUNCEA/SANAPPAI/NITROGEN FIXING PLANT SEED (WITH FREE PLANT SEEDS) Crotalaria juncea, known as brown,Indian,Madras,SANAPPAI is a tropical Asian plant of the legume family (Fabaceae).
It is generally considered to have originated in India.Sanappai(Crotalaria juncea L.) is a multipurpose tropical and subtropical legume grown in many countries, notably India, mainly for its high quality fibre.
The crop is grown for green manure, as a soil improver and as a disease break in cereal or other croprotations. Sanappai is locally used as fodder.
Sanappai, like hemp, is mainly grown as a fibre crop that was much used in the traditional manufacture of ropes, strings, twines, floor mat, and fishing nets.
